Researchers have developed a deep learning model, YOLO11, to detect fishing vessels using nighttime light satellite imagery. This dual-branch architecture, processing both panchromatic and RGB data, achieved high performance metrics including a 0.96 mAP@50. When applied to the coast of India, the model identified over 31,000 vessel instances, with a significant majority (77.3%) identified as potential "dark vessels" lacking AIS transmission. The study also revealed peak fishing activity between January and April, concentrated within 50-100 km of the coastline. AI
